How Profitable is a Smoothie Truck?

While the profitability of a smoothie truck varies from city to city, the overall industry is highly profitable. The average Jamba Juice franchise generates $700,000 a year, and the cost to open and operate a smoothie store is $350,000 a year. With this type of profit margin, you should be able to maintain a comfortable level of living. If you become popular with your customers, you may want to expand and open a sit-down restaurant or food truck.

In order to begin operating a smoothie truck, you must own a food truck. These trucks can cost between $50,000 and $250,000, depending on the size. If you’re unsure of the size of the truck you should purchase, consider purchasing a used one. Next, determine the power source for your truck. Will you plug in or run off of a generator? Also, don’t forget to factor in the cost of fuel and labor.

Is a Juice Company Profitable?

Start by determining your profit margin. Juices should have a 50% to 70% gross margin. This means that your juice business will need to cover its overhead. If the margin is too low, you should either increase prices or cut costs. o Establish a distribution system. Many POS systems feature a built-in loyalty program that encourages repeat business and keeps customers coming back for more. You can even invest in a digital loyalty program that tracks customer usage and engagement and sends customers reminders about promotions. o Consider franchises. There are many national and regional companies that offer juice bar franchises. They have tested recipes and prep methods. These franchises also offer brand recognition to help you attract new customers.

o Consider location. Location is crucial to juice bar success. Make sure your location is a high-traffic location, with ample parking. It’s also important to consider how much money you’re willing to spend on rent. If you can afford it, a high-traffic location is probably worth it, especially if you’re only going to get business from impulse shoppers. Keep in mind that the cost of renting a location should not exceed six percent of gross sales.
